Originally Posted by mpeters1200
I have a question for Glenn.

I know that you really like your 66, but I'm having a heck of a time getting used to her. The VSM shop insisted I buy a zig zag foot for the ideal 1/4 inch. I swear it's wrong. I can't keep a steady 1/4 inch seam and I don't know if I'll ever piece on her. Do you have any hints? I do not want to put tape or other adhesive on her. Scared it'll ruin her beautiful finish.

The other question I have, how can you FMQ on a 66 if you can't drop the feed dogs? Is there a plate that goes over it? The guy I got the machine from insisted that you can just remove the feed dogs, but I'm worried that will cause damage to the machine if I don't put them back in right. What would you suggest?

Thank you. I love looking at the pics of your newest acquisition. You've been such a supporter of the 66's I'd hate to see you start using a different machine. :)
I'm not Glenn but I have 3 Redeye 66's and I love them. I use one of those magnetic seam guides you can get at Joanns or Hobby Lobby or some sewing centers. It works just great and if you don't have one, measure your 1/4 inch and put a stack of small sticky notes down. I've done that in a pinch and if it won't stay down for you long enough use some of the blue painters tape, no icky sticky stuff remains. Hope this helps. :lol:
